Output 268ad04c46e0f23a8d60b4b57b06cd81b1db141d3d4a3e773b3f6ffd66226384:37

value
44531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bf83b071424bc94e98a634fa530f20da31d54f OP_EQUAL
address
34QJwm7bKzX4Rh53xW5AapzpGUpnncktLA
transaction
268ad04c46e0f23a8d60b4b57b06cd81b1db141d3d4a3e773b3f6ffd66226384
spent
true